    The Mark V90, Longest running Mark Series to date

    Ciao Hello, I had problems exactly today with the Mark v footswitch. I can tell you after several attempts, that the problem was in the central pin of the dpdt of the eq switch . The track (ground) was no longer in contact. I solved it by creating a bridge with a wire to ground.
